1. Ada Health

Ada Health’s AI-powered chatbot assists users in diagnosing their symptoms and offers guidance on the next steps. When users interact with the chatbot, it asks specific questions related to their responses, age, gender, and medical history. This approach allows Ada to gather important information and deliver accurate advice based on the user’s unique situation. One of Ada’s standout features is its ability to explain medical terms in simple language. If a user is unsure about a symptom or condition, the AI offers clear and easy-to-understand explanations. This educational element helps users gain a better understanding of their health and empowers them to make informed decisions about seeking medical care.

3. Buoy Health

Buoy Health offers an AI-powered platform that helps patients evaluate their symptoms and suggests possible diagnoses. The platform reduces the burden on healthcare systems by filtering cases before they require a visit to a doctor or clinic. The chatbot leads users through a systematic assessment, cutting down on unnecessary doctor visits while ensuring those in need receive prompt medical care. Using natural language processing and AI, Buoy Health evaluates symptoms thoroughly, providing insightful information about what might be happening. Additionally, it directs users to suitable healthcare resources, including doctors, clinics, or telemedicine services.

4. Woebot 

Woebot is an AI chatbot that offers mental health support based on c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) principles. It helps users manage their emotional well-being, even when a therapist is unavailable. Through ongoing conversations, Woebot tracks mood changes and guides users through therapeutic exercises like mood tracking and cognitive restructuring. Additionally, if needed, it directs users to appropriate healthcare resources. The chatbot interacts with users using a blend of multiple-choice options and free-text input. This method allows Woebot to understand user responses and provide helpful feedback, focusing on mental health improvement rather than trying to replicate human empathy.

6. Babylon Health 

Babylon Health uses AI and telemedicine to give patients quick access to medical advice through a chatbot and virtual consultations. This approach improves access to healthcare while cutting down on costs. It enhances the process of triage and remote medical services, making healthcare delivery more efficient. The system relies on a large medical database to evaluate user inputs, taking into account details like symptoms, medical history, and lifestyle. When a patient interacts with Babylon’s chatbot, they are asked a series of questions about their symptoms. The AI then analyzes the responses, comparing them with its medical database.

8. Lark Health

Lark Health uses conversational AI to make it easier for patients to stay engaged and manage chronic conditions more effectively. Through its digital health platform, users receive round-the-clock coaching via a simple text-based chat. This system draws from behavioral science to encourage healthy, long-term habits. Instead of generic advice, Lark responds based on each user’s behavior and health data. The platform focuses on key areas such as diet, exercise, sleep, and stress. As users interact with the app, it delivers timely suggestions and educational tips that help them take control of their health in a more personal and manageable way.

15. HealthTap

HealthTap has a chatbot integrated with Facebook Messenger, allowing patients to easily submit health-related questions. Once submitted, the questions are reviewed by doctors partnered with HealthTap, who provide answers directly through the chatbot. If the response doesn’t fully address the issue, users have the option to request a live consultation via text or video chat on the app. In addition to these features, HealthTap’s AI chatbot helps with managing chronic conditions by enabling patients to monitor vital signs, log symptoms, and stay in touch with their healthcare providers for continuous care. This approach promotes patient adherence and contributes to long-term health management.

16. GYANT

GYANT is a symptom checker chatbot available on platforms like Facebook Messenger and Alexa. The chatbot is built to respond to text-based queries about symptoms, providing answers in a conversational way, similar to how a customer service representative would. When users type in their symptoms, GYANT uses artificial intelligence to analyze the input, cross-referencing it with extensive medical data. Based on this, it suggests possible next steps. Patients also have the option to chat with a licensed physician through the app for more personalized guidance or use the virtual assistant for general information.

18. Izzy

Izzy is a friendly virtual assistant created to help women manage their menstrual and sexual health. Available on Messenger, this chatbot offers support by reminding users to take their birth control pills, track their fertility window, and anticipate their next period. In addition, Izzy provides guidance on various menstrual health topics and checks in on your well-being, especially during moments when you may not feel your best. With its helpful, conversational approach, Izzy is a reliable companion for navigating the challenges of menstrual health.

19. SkinVision 

SkinVision uses artificial intelligence to examine moles and lesions, helping users detect potential skin cancer risks early. The app offers an easy and accessible way for people to monitor their skin health, even when they don’t have immediate access to a dermatologist. This AI-powered tool boosts the chances of identifying issues early, giving users a better shot at timely treatment. Backed by a highly accurate AI algorithm and supported by a global network of top dermatologists, SkinVision ensures a reliable and expert-driven experience for users.

 21. AliveCor

AliveCor’s main product, the KardiaMobile, is a compact ECG device that uses AI to detect atrial fibrillation (AFib) and other irregular heart rhythms. This portable device allows users to capture medical-grade ECGs with just a smartphone, making it easier to monitor heart health and detect issues early. With this technology, users can keep track of their cardiovascular condition at home, reducing the need for regular trips to the clinic. The AI-powered device not only helps individuals take charge of their heart health but also gives doctors crucial information to act quickly if needed.

22.  Polaris

Polaris AI chatbots, created by Hippocratic AI supports non-diagnostic conversations between patients and AI agents, improving both safety and empathy in healthcare environments. Polaris uses a unique model, with several specialized large language models (LLMs) working together to enhance functionality. This collaborative approach allows the AI agents to engage in dynamic conversations with patients, assisting with tasks like providing dietary advice and managing medication schedules, all while improving operational efficiency.

23. Elise AI

Elise AI is an innovative company in the healthcare AI industry, focusing on automating administrative tasks and improving patient engagement through conversational AI. The platform uses nat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ning to handle patient interactions across various channels like voice, SMS, email, and webchat. This technology allows healthcare providers to dedicate more time to patient care while boosting operational efficiency. Elise AI’s system can manage tasks such as triaging patient requests, onboarding new patients, scheduling and rescheduling appointments, and explaining bills. It integrates smoothly with EHRs and patient management systems, ensuring compliance with HIPAA standards and maintaining data security.
